“Teenager in Love” (1959) was a #5 hit for Dion & The Belmonts. Written by Doc Pomus and Mort Shuman, it captures the angst of young romance (“How can somebody so young / Feel so old inside?”). Dion’s plaintive lead vocal over the Belmonts’ harmonies made it a doo-wop classic. Fun fact: Pomus said he wrote it about a real heartbreak from his youth, lending authenticity to its teenage drama.
